檢測到您已登錄華為云國際站賬號,為了您更好的體驗,建議您訪問國際站服務(wù)網(wǎng)站 http://www.cqfng.cn/intl/zh-cn
不再顯示此消息
目錄 文章目錄 目錄 HAProxy 負載均衡器 應(yīng)用特性 性能優(yōu)勢 會話保持 健康檢查 配置文件 負載均衡策略 ACL 規(guī)則 Web 監(jiān)控平臺 Keepalived 虛擬路由器 核心組件 VRRP 虛擬路由冗余協(xié)議 VRRP
略進行負載均衡時,意味著期望同一個用戶能夠一直訪問到同一臺服務(wù)器上,就像下圖這樣。 ▲圖中的hash函數(shù)是最簡單的隨意舉例 如此一來,我們只需要在這一臺服務(wù)器上將這個用戶相關(guān)的信息緩存在進程內(nèi),就能起到非常高性價比的提升性能的效果。 這時,客戶端與服務(wù)端之間的相當于建立了一個信任
2MB流量,建議閱讀9分鐘。 上一篇《分布式系統(tǒng)關(guān)注點——初識「高可用」》我們對「高可用」有了一個初步認識,其中認為「負載均衡」是「高可用」的核心工作。那么,本篇將通過圖文并茂的方式,來描述出每一種負載均衡策略的完整樣貌。 一、「負載均衡」是什么 正如題圖所示的這樣,由一個獨立的統(tǒng)一入口來收斂流量
(不管是否正確同步)所有的線程都只能看到一個單一的操作執(zhí)行順序,每個操作都必須原子執(zhí)行且立刻對所有線程可見。 圖示: 順序一致性內(nèi)存模型視圖 在概念上,順序一致性模型有一個單一的全局內(nèi)存,這個內(nèi)存通過一個左右擺動的開關(guān)可以連接到任意一個線程,同時每一個線程必須按照程序的順序來執(zhí)行內(nèi)存
靠。 2.1 最終一致性 若應(yīng)用正好從一個異步的從節(jié)點讀取時,而該從節(jié)點落后于主節(jié)點,它可能會看到過期數(shù)據(jù),導(dǎo)致數(shù)據(jù)庫中不一致:由于并非所有寫入都反映在從節(jié)點,若同時對主、從節(jié)點發(fā)起相同查詢,可能得到不同結(jié)果。這種不一致只是暫時的狀態(tài),若停止寫DB,并等待一段時間,從節(jié)點最終會
衡概述負載均衡有兩種:基于負載均衡算法和基于一致性哈希。對于基于負載均衡算法的配置十分簡便,只要在simpleLB配上響應(yīng)的字段即可。算法字段描述ROUND_ROBIN簡單的輪訓(xùn)算法,這也是默認的方式LEAST_CONN隨機選擇兩個健康的主機,并且在兩者中選擇連接數(shù)少的一個RAN
com返回4個IP地址中的哪一個。最簡單的DNS決策算法就是輪轉(zhuǎn)。 1.DNS輪轉(zhuǎn) 最常見的重定向技術(shù)之一也是最簡單的重定向技術(shù)之一。DNS輪轉(zhuǎn)使用了DNS主機名解析中的一項特性,在Web服務(wù)器集群中平衡負載。這是一種單純的負載均衡策略,沒有考慮任何與客戶端和服務(wù)器的相對位置,或者服務(wù)器當前負載有關(guān)的因素。
需求和負載情況,幫助制定更準確的資源調(diào)度和負載均衡計劃。 云監(jiān)控服務(wù)帶來的挑戰(zhàn) 盡管云監(jiān)控服務(wù)在資源調(diào)度與負載均衡中有諸多優(yōu)勢,但也面臨一些挑戰(zhàn): 數(shù)據(jù)安全:云監(jiān)控服務(wù)涉及到大量的敏感數(shù)據(jù),對數(shù)據(jù)的安全性提出了更高的要求,需要采取相應(yīng)的安全措施來保護數(shù)據(jù)的隱私和完整性。 數(shù)據(jù)
上一篇給大家介紹了備份數(shù)據(jù)一致性的概念,以及云服務(wù)器的崩潰一致性備份,今天給大家介紹應(yīng)用一致性備份。所謂應(yīng)用一致性備份,就是指除了崩潰一致性做到的云服務(wù)器所有數(shù)據(jù)在同一時間點創(chuàng)建備份外,還在數(shù)據(jù)備份前觸發(fā)數(shù)據(jù)庫提交所有事務(wù),并刷新OS內(nèi)存臟數(shù)據(jù),保證磁盤上保存的數(shù)據(jù)庫數(shù)據(jù)是一致的
背景> 數(shù)據(jù)庫數(shù)據(jù)遷移過程,特別是遷移過程中,雙方數(shù)據(jù)雙加載過程中,如何校驗數(shù)據(jù)加工一致時,引出了數(shù)據(jù)一致性比對;> 本節(jié)只是提供校驗的方法,供大家探討;具體解決方案可聯(lián)系樓主。數(shù)值型> 除了本身精度不確定類型,雙方用法一致,可以直接sum聚合;時間型>時間可以分為time、date(TD兼容
協(xié)商售賣時間,比如一三五A賣,二四六B賣3.成立個第三方存票機構(gòu),它統(tǒng)一發(fā)票通過以上的設(shè)計,可以看出一個很重要的解決一致性算法的解決思路,即:將可能引發(fā)不一致的并行操作進行串行化,就是現(xiàn)在計算機系統(tǒng)里處理分布式一致性問題基礎(chǔ)思路和唯一秘訣
今天給大家介紹一下備份數(shù)據(jù)一致性的概念,業(yè)界對備份一致性的定義包括3類:不一致備份:云服務(wù)器中文件或磁盤數(shù)據(jù)的備份,不在同一時間點產(chǎn)生。崩潰一致性備份:云服務(wù)器中文件或磁盤數(shù)據(jù)的備份,在同一時間點產(chǎn)生,但不會靜默數(shù)據(jù)庫等應(yīng)用系統(tǒng)、不會備份內(nèi)存數(shù)據(jù),不保證應(yīng)用系統(tǒng)備份的一致性。應(yīng)用一致
create or replace function getchecksql(tab in varchar2, own in varchar2) return textisdeclareretval varchar2(2300);begin retval:='select count(*)
前言 在上一篇《Intel HDSLB 高性能四層負載均衡器 — 快速入門和應(yīng)用場景》中,我們著重介紹了 HDSLB(High Density Scalable Load Balancer,高密度可擴展的負載均衡器)作為新一代高性能四層負載均衡器的需求定位、分析了 HDSLB
經(jīng)開始備份。公司的HR通過系統(tǒng)查詢小李信息時,發(fā)現(xiàn)還是本科,小李的申請被駁回。這就是數(shù)據(jù)不一致問題。 2.數(shù)據(jù)庫的一致性:是指數(shù)據(jù)庫從一個一致性狀態(tài)變到另一個一致性狀態(tài)。這是事務(wù)的一致性的定義。 舉個例子:倉庫中商品A有100件,門店中商品A有10件。上午10點,倉庫發(fā)送商品
? > 0,當 m → ∞ 時,有 P (|θˆm − θ| > ?) → 0。式(5.55)表示的條件被稱為一致性 (consistency)。有時它是指弱一致性,強一致性是指幾乎必然 (almost sure) 從 θˆ 收斂到 θ。幾乎必然收斂 (almost sure convergence)
思考 對于這種一致性問題,可以使用通用的方案,也就是當修改數(shù)據(jù)庫中的數(shù)據(jù)后,將對應(yīng)的緩存清空,Redis的緩存好辦,可以直接刪除掉 但是本地緩存就會有個問題,如果存在多實例,那么要怎么處理? 就拿節(jié)目服務(wù)來說,假設(shè)線上部署了5個實例節(jié)點,經(jīng)過一段時間運行后,每個實例都有了自己的本
針對同一個對象或桶的操作,比如多個客戶端對同一個對象并行上傳、查詢和刪除時,具體操作結(jié)果依賴于操作到達系統(tǒng)的時間和系統(tǒng)內(nèi)部處理的時延,可能返回不一致的結(jié)果。比如,當多個客戶端并行上傳同一個對象時,系統(tǒng)最后收到的上傳請求會覆蓋前一個上傳的對象。如果需要避免同一個對象被并行訪問,需要在上層應(yīng)用中增加對象的鎖機制。
在分布式系統(tǒng)中,由于存在多個節(jié)點之間的通信和數(shù)據(jù)同步問題,實現(xiàn)一致性是一個非常重要的問題。本文將介紹如何在分布式系統(tǒng)中實現(xiàn)一致性,并討論一些常見的一致性協(xié)議和算法。 什么是一致性? 在分布式系統(tǒng)中,一致性指的是多個節(jié)點之間數(shù)據(jù)的一致性。具體而言,如果一個節(jié)點對數(shù)據(jù)進行了更新操作,那么其他節(jié)點也必
略進行負載均衡時,意味著期望同一個用戶能夠一直訪問到同一臺服務(wù)器上,就像下圖這樣?!鴪D中的hash函數(shù)是最簡單的隨意舉例 如此一來,我們只需要在這一臺服務(wù)器上將這個用戶相關(guān)的信息緩存在進程內(nèi),就能起到非常高性價比的提升性能的效果。 這時,客戶端與服務(wù)端之間的相當于建立了一個信任,